body {
background: black;
font-family: Verdana, Arial, 'Sans-serif';
font-size:16px;
font-size:1.6rem;
padding:20px;
}
.container-fluid {
margin-right: auto;
margin-left: auto;
max-width: 1600px;
}
h1, h2, h3, h4 {
font-weight: normal;
line-height:110%;
}
h1 {
text-align: center;
font-size: 15px;
font-size: 1.5rem;	
}
h2 {
font-size: 18px;
font-size: 1.8rem;
padding:10px 0;
margin-bottom:2px;
}
h1.cat {
font-size:25px;
}
.hrCat {
width:5%;
margin:10px auto;
height:2px;
background-color: transparent;
background: none;
border:none;
box-shadow: 0 0 2px #fff;
}
h5.imageTitle {
font-size: 13px;
margin-bottom: 5px;
}
p.location {
font-size: 10px;
font-style: italic;
}
a {
text-decoration: none;
}
a:visited {
}
.pagemenu a:visited {
}
.thumb {
text-align: right;
}
.thumbtext {
padding: 4px 0px 0px 0px;
}
.imagetext, .pagemenu {
padding: 0;
}
.indexr {
margin: 18px 0px 0px 0px;
}
p {
margin: 0 0 9px 0;
font-size:11px;
font-size:1.1rem;
}
form {
font-size:11px;
font-size:1.1rem;
}
.glyphicon {
margin-right:10px;
}
.company-logo {
display:block;
width:15%;
min-width:150px;
border:0;
margin:50px auto;
}
.clfloat {
display:block;
clear:both;
}
.catLink {
display:block;
width:90%;
height:100%;
position:absolute;
top:0;
left:0;
}
.imgThumbs {
width:100%;
}
.backLink {
max-width:800px;
max-height:450px;  
}

/*-----------------------*/
/*------  LOG IN  -------*/
/*-----------------------*/
#login-form {
display:block;  
min-width:300px;
min-height:auto;
width:40%;
height:40%;
margin:20px auto;
padding:10px 20px;
text-align:center;
}
#login-form label, #login-form input {
float:left;
padding:2px 10px 2px 0;
margin:5px 0;
font-size:14px;
font-size:1.4rem;
}
#login-form label, #login-form input[type="submit"] {
clear:left;
text-align:center;
}
#login-form input[type="text"], #login-form input[type="password"] {
width:60%;
}
#login-form label {
text-align:left;
width:100px;
font-weight:normal;
}
input#login-in {
padding:2px 10px;
margin-left:100px;
border-radius:5px;
}
#err-msg {
display:block;
text-align:center;
}
.restricted_msg {  
display:block;
width:100%;
margin-bottom:20px;
text-align:center;
font-size:12px;
font-size:1.2rem;
}
.logOut {
text-align:center;
margin-bottom: 50px;
}
/*-----------------------*/
/*------  CUSTOM  -------*/
/*-----------------------*/
.catBlock {
padding-left: 2px;
padding-right: 2px;
}